Frederick J. Simmons Obituary

West Edmeston-Frederick J. Simmons,68, a life resident of Brookfield, passed away peacefully on Thursday, April 27, 2017, at the Mohawk Valley Health Care Center.He was born in Utica on May 20, 1948, the son of the late Leonard G. and Martha J. McConnell Simmons. Fred was a graduate of Brookfield Central School, and he furthered his education, graduating from SUNY Morrisville. He was a proud American Dairy Farmer, working his farm and tending to his cattle for 45 years. In 1995, at the First Baptist Church of Brookfield, Fred married Christine Neal. Fred had many passions, he was an avid Yankee's Fan, and enjoyed working alongside his friend, Bernie Whitacre in his Bernie's wood working shop. He will most be remembered as a loving and devoted husband, father, grandfather, and friend.Fred is survived by his beloved wife of 22 years, Christine; his two beloved daughters and their husbands, Carrie and Dennis Miller and Amy and Tony Cellamare; his cherished grandchildren, Colt and Alex Miller, and Renae and Tori Cellamare; his cousins: Florence Burnett, Sharon Woolsey, Carl Simmons, Jr., and Pam Witter. Fred also leaves behind dear friends, Bernie and Nancy Whitacre, and Bruce and Ester Tanner.He was predeceased by his parents, a brother and sister-in-law, Carl and Elizabeth Simmons, as well as cousins Linda Tilbe and Leonard SimmonsFred's family extends a special thank you to nurses and staff at Mohawk Valley Health Care Center in Ilion, for the care and compassion given to Fred. Funeral services will be held on Monday, May 1, 2017 at 4 PM at the Brookfield First Baptist Church, with the Re. Mark Thall Officiating. Interment will be in Deansboro Cemetery. There will be calling hours from 2-4 PM prior to the funeral service.In lieu of flowers, please consider donations to the Resident's Fund of the Mohawk Valley Heath Care Center, 99 Sixth Avenue, Ilion, New York 13357.
